Accredited by Languages Canada and the Private Training Institutions Branch of the Ministry of Advanced Education, Skills and Training, St Giles Vancouver upholds the highest standards of language education. With a total of 12 classrooms, the majority of which are equipped with Interactive Whiteboards, the school fosters an interactive and dynamic learning environment. Furthermore, the institution boasts essential resources, including a language laboratory, a computer room, a library area, and a welcoming student café and lounge, ensuring students have access to all they need to study effectively and unwind comfortably.
Conveniently situated in the heart of downtown Vancouver, St Giles enjoys proximity to an extensive public transportation network, allowing easy accessibility. The school is just moments away from the city's major shopping streets and entertainment venues, adding to the vibrant experience. Moreover, the captivating Stanley Park and nearby beaches are within convenient walking distance, offering students the opportunity to relish the natural beauty of the area while pursuing their language learning journey.
